A frictionless piston traps a fixed mass of an ideal gas. The gas undergoes three thermodynamic processes in a cycle.
The initial conditions of the gas at A are:
volume = 0.330 m3
pressure = 129 kPa
temperature = 27.0 °C
Process AB is an isothermal change, as shown on the pressure volume (pV) diagram, in which the gas expands to three times its initial volume.
Calculate the pressure of the gas at B.
[2]
use of pV = constant ✓
PB = 43 «Kpa» ✓

The gas now undergoes adiabatic compression BC until it returns to the initial volume. To complete the cycle, the gas returns to A via the isovolumetric process CA.
Sketch, on the pV diagram, the remaining two processes BC and CA that the gas undergoes.
[2]
concave curved line from B to locate C with a higher pressure than A ✓
vertical line joining C to A ✓

Explain why the change of entropy for the gas during the process BC is equal to zero.
[1]
ALTERNATIVE 1
«the process is adiabatic so» ΔQ = 0 ✓
ALTERNATIVE 2
The compression is reversible «so ΔS = 0» ✓

Explain why the work done by the gas during the isothermal expansion AB is less than the work done on the gas during the adiabatic compression BC.
[1]
area under curve AB is less than area under curve BC ✓

The quantity of trapped gas is 53.2 mol. Calculate the thermal energy removed from the gas during process CA.
[2]
«W = 0 so» Q = ΔU ✓
«ΔU = × 53.2 × R × (351 – 27) so » ΔU = 2.15 × 105 «J» ✓
